The Opportunity:


The Open Text Professional Services team is comprised of more than 3000 consultants who act as trusted advisors, managing long-lasting relationships with more than 100,000 customers around the world.

They are responsible for the delivery of business solutions from pre-sales to post implementation.

Our teams of experts help organizations solve issues, create value, improve business performance, and work more effectively in an increasingly digital world.


OpenText (OT) Professional Services is an enabler to our customers seeking to realize Return on Investment (ROI) from their investment in OpenText Enterprise Information Management (EIM) products.

As a Client Manager of Professional Services for the North America US East Region, you will be responsible for many aspects of Professional Services including selling services, supporting license and cloud sales by providing necessary services information concerning the implementation of the solutions proposed and the overall customer relationship regarding all Professional Services offerings.

The position requires the selected applicant to live in the Eastern time zone.


Such services include the implementation of solutions based on OT products including development and support of limited Fastrack solutions as well as custom solutions.

The Client Manager role works closely with the rest of the customer account team including (primarily) Client Directors, but also License Sales, technical pre-sales and OT Practice Leads for other value-add services that can be provided to the clients in relation to solution realization including learning services, managed services, and cloud services.

The Client Manager will at times be responsible for working with OpenText Professional Services Partners for staffing of projects where OpenText Consultants are not currently available.


The Client Manager is responsible for Professional Services sales and establishing an acceptable opportunity sold margin within US East Region.


You are great at:

  • Supporting Opportunities as part of Client Director Sales team.
  • Generating revenue opportunities by developing solutions for clients and Service Offering using creativity and the available tools.
  • Creating a pipeline of opportunities (in concert with Client Directors) to generate bookings meeting quarterly budget expectations.
  • Negotiating project deliverables/schedules/costing for services from external suppliers or other groups within Open Text.
  • Ensuring timely delivery and management of resource forecasting, opportunity forecasting, proposal/SOW writing and achieving required approvals, contract and invoicing status using appropriate tools available.
  • Understanding revenue forecasting and be able to report accurately on Quarterly revenue and bookings to the Regional Vice-President.
  • Providing leadership in promoting, identifying, recommending, and implementing improvements to any processes.
  • Formulating and managing strategies and project plans including:
oManagement of deliverables

oDealing with Customer Sr. Management and C-Level executives.

  • Selling Professional Services to commercial sector accounts.

What it takes:

  • University Degree or College Diploma and/or relevant IM/IT experience (5+ years) or equivalent.
  • At least 4 years of experience with IT systems.
  • Experience in managing teams and direct reports; ensuring objectives are met on time and budget.
  • Expertise in complex business and technical processes and their implications across the enterprise. Knowledge of project management disciplines and processes.
  • Experience selling Professional Services.
  • Knowledge of the Open Text product offerings and how to associate such to client's business requirements.
  • Ability to use standard methodologies to quickly evaluate and size an opportunity. Being able to quickly assemble business requirements to OT modules and provide an estimate for budgetary purposes.
  • Have experience selling to and/or working for major corporations within the Eastern United States client base is preferred.
  • Strong presence and confidence, exhibiting professional maturity, strong communication skills with at least 5 to 10 years working experience.
  • Solid work ethic with a willingness to 'do what it takes' to meet client demands.
